diff options
author | android-build-team Robot <android-build-team-robot@google.com> | 2019-05-18 23:32:22 +0000 |
---|---|---|
committer | android-build-team Robot <android-build-team-robot@google.com> | 2019-05-18 23:32:22 +0000 |
commit | 1fecc6563db859451e81c27c0f6265822c6cde18 (patch) | |
tree | 791d2dfecf40ccdda3c173e9a273324e62065b9b | |
parent | a1e612b01b559554a85f03c39b01d8cf8f47fc2b (diff) | |
parent | 7de39616a5c0a06638a700aba8027b2c50919e6a (diff) | |
download | CellBroadcastReceiver-1fecc6563db859451e81c27c0f6265822c6cde18.tar.gz |
Snap for 5582435 from 7de39616a5c0a06638a700aba8027b2c50919e6a to qt-qpr1-release
Change-Id: I054f044c3f12f3278d1c66db76684a67925f5a85
-rw-r--r-- | res/values-mr/strings.xml | 4 | ||||
-rw-r--r-- | res/values-te/strings.xml | 2 | ||||
-rw-r--r-- | res/values-vi/strings.xml | 2 | ||||
-rw-r--r-- | src/com/android/cellbroadcastreceiver/CellBroadcastAlertAudio.java | 10 |
4 files changed, 11 insertions, 7 deletions
diff --git a/res/values-mr/strings.xml b/res/values-mr/strings.xml index 015c8e2bf..c97b74f2c 100644 --- a/res/values-mr/strings.xml +++ b/res/values-mr/strings.xml @@ -51,7 +51,7 @@ <string name="emergency_alerts_title" msgid="6605036374197485429">"सूचना"</string> <string name="notification_channel_broadcast_messages" msgid="880704362482824524">"प्रसारण मेसेज"</string> <string name="notification_channel_emergency_alerts" msgid="5008287980979183617">"आणीबाणीच्या सूचना"</string> - <string name="enable_alerts_master_toggle_title" msgid="1457904343636699446">"सूचनांची अनुमती द्या"</string> + <string name="enable_alerts_master_toggle_title" msgid="1457904343636699446">"सूचनांना अनुमती द्या"</string> <string name="enable_alerts_master_toggle_summary" msgid="699552922381916044">"आणीबाणी सूचना मिळवा"</string> <string name="alert_reminder_interval_title" msgid="7466642011937564868">"सूचना रिमाइंडरचा आवाज"</string> <string name="enable_alert_speech_title" msgid="8052104771053526941">"सूचना मेसेज बोला"</string> @@ -116,7 +116,7 @@ <string name="delivery_time_heading" msgid="5980836543433619329">"प्राप्त झाले:"</string> <string name="notification_multiple" msgid="5121978148152124860">"<xliff:g id="COUNT">%s</xliff:g> न वाचलेल्या सूचना."</string> <string name="notification_multiple_title" msgid="1523638925739947855">"नवीन सूचना"</string> - <string name="show_cmas_opt_out_summary" msgid="6926059266585295440">"पहिली सूचना (राष्ट्रपतींच्या सूचनेव्यतिरिक्त) प्रदर्शित केल्यानंतर निवड रद्द करा डायलॉग दाखवा."</string> + <string name="show_cmas_opt_out_summary" msgid="6926059266585295440">"पहिली सूचना (राष्ट्रपतींच्या सूचनेव्यतिरिक्त) डिस्प्ले केल्यानंतर निवड रद्द करा डायलॉग दाखवा."</string> <string name="show_cmas_opt_out_title" msgid="9182104842820171132">"निवड रद्द करा संवाद दर्शवा"</string> <string name="cmas_opt_out_dialog_text" msgid="7529010670998259128">"तुम्ही सध्या आणीबाणी सूचना प्राप्त करत आहात. तुम्ही आणीबाणी सूचना प्राप्त करणे सुरु ठेऊ इच्छिता का?"</string> <string name="cmas_opt_out_button_yes" msgid="7248930667195432936">"होय"</string> diff --git a/res/values-te/strings.xml b/res/values-te/strings.xml index fb402f5ed..bd8331715 100644 --- a/res/values-te/strings.xml +++ b/res/values-te/strings.xml @@ -75,7 +75,7 @@ <string name="enable_emergency_alerts_message_title" msgid="661894007489847468">"అత్యవసర హెచ్చరికలు"</string> <string name="enable_emergency_alerts_message_summary" msgid="7574617515441602546">"ప్రాణాంతకమైన సంఘటనల గురించి హెచ్చరించు"</string> <string name="enable_cmas_test_alerts_title" msgid="1319231576046146463">"నెలవారీ పరీక్ష అవసరం"</string> - <string name="enable_cmas_test_alerts_summary" msgid="588517403520088484">"భద్రతా హెచ్చరిక సిస్టమ్ కోసం పరీక్ష సందేశాలను స్వీకరించండి"</string> + <string name="enable_cmas_test_alerts_summary" msgid="588517403520088484">"భద్రతా హెచ్చరిక సిస్టమ్ కోసం టెస్ట్ సందేశాలను స్వీకరించండి"</string> <string name="enable_alert_vibrate_title" msgid="5421032189422312508">"వైబ్రేషన్"</string> <string name="use_full_volume_title" msgid="8581439612945182255">"పూర్తి వాల్యూమ్ను ఉపయోగించు"</string> <string name="use_full_volume_summary" msgid="3560764277281704697">"ఇతర వాల్యూమ్ మరియు అంతరాయం కలిగించవద్దు ప్రాధాన్యతలను విస్మరిస్తుంది"</string> diff --git a/res/values-vi/strings.xml b/res/values-vi/strings.xml index 5f687bd59..f8e44343b 100644 --- a/res/values-vi/strings.xml +++ b/res/values-vi/strings.xml @@ -127,7 +127,7 @@ <item msgid="9097229303902157183">"2 phút một lần"</item> <item msgid="5718214950343391480">"5 phút một lần"</item> <item msgid="3863339891188103437">"15 phút một lần"</item> - <item msgid="6868848414437854609">"Tắt"</item> + <item msgid="6868848414437854609">"Đang tắt"</item> </string-array> <string name="emergency_alert_settings_title_watches" msgid="4477073412799894883">"Cảnh báo khẩn cấp không dây"</string> </resources> diff --git a/src/com/android/cellbroadcastreceiver/CellBroadcastAlertAudio.java b/src/com/android/cellbroadcastreceiver/CellBroadcastAlertAudio.java index ee8db74e2..8d913dfe1 100644 --- a/src/com/android/cellbroadcastreceiver/CellBroadcastAlertAudio.java +++ b/src/com/android/cellbroadcastreceiver/CellBroadcastAlertAudio.java @@ -344,7 +344,8 @@ public class CellBroadcastAlertAudio extends Service implements TextToSpeech.OnI // stop() checks to see if we are already playing. stop(); - log("playAlertTone: alertType=" + alertType); + log("playAlertTone: alertType=" + alertType + ", mEnableVibrate=" + mEnableVibrate + + ", mEnableAudio=" + mEnableAudio + ", mUseFullVolume=" + mUseFullVolume); Resources res = CellBroadcastSettings.getResourcesForDefaultSmsSubscriptionId( getApplicationContext()); @@ -365,10 +366,13 @@ public class CellBroadcastAlertAudio extends Service implements TextToSpeech.OnI vibrateDuration += patternArray[i]; } - // Use the alarm channel so it can vibrate in DnD mode, unless alarms are - // specifically disabled in DnD. AudioAttributes.Builder attrBuilder = new AudioAttributes.Builder(); attrBuilder.setUsage(AudioAttributes.USAGE_ALARM); + if (mUseFullVolume) { + // Set the flags to bypass DnD mode if the user enables use full volume option. + attrBuilder.setFlags(AudioAttributes.FLAG_BYPASS_INTERRUPTION_POLICY + | AudioAttributes.FLAG_BYPASS_MUTE); + } AudioAttributes attr = attrBuilder.build(); // If we only play the tone once, then we also play the vibration pattern once. int repeatIndex = (customAlertDuration < 0) |